THE BLESSING OF THE LORD ! You must shed the cares of this world on purpose, you have to make a quality decision, and give them to Jesus. Then, you must leave them in His hands by bringing into captivity every thought to the obedience of Christ. That isn't always easy particularly when your mind is inundated with the thoughts and ideas of the world, but you can do it if you'll just remember that when you give your cares to Jesus, He receives them. When you put the situation that has concerned you into His hands and said to Him, "Lord, will you take care of this for me ?" He says, "Of course I will" ! One day, when I was rolling the care of a particular situation over on The Lord, he said it to me this way, Bobby, I will take care of it. I will be your Caretaker. And that was just a few days ago ! He pointed out to me that if I were to hire someone to be the caretaker of a piece of property, landscaping the find gardens and hedges, I wouldn't hire just anyone with a mower who knows nothing about gardening. I'd find someone trained and equipped to handle the job. I'd go looking for a caretaker who could tend to that property better than I ever could. Once I found him, I'd stop worrying about it and leave the property in his hands. That's what we do with Jesus. We let Him be our Caretaker because He is well able to do the job. Then we relax and enter into His rest. "Oh, Brother Lewis, I couldn't possibly relax right now ! My family is facing a financial crisis that could absolutely ruin us. It would be irresponsible for me not to be upset about it." As long as you take that attitude, you're trying to be your own god and you don't qualify for that position. You're supposed to be at peace. You're supposed to have a heart (soul) that's not troubled. You're supposed to be free of care because the cares of this world will choke the Word of Faith out of you. and without faith it's impossible for you to receive anything from The Lord. Jesus went to great lengths to teach us that in the parable of the sower. He said: "Now these are the ones sown among thorns; they are the ones who hear The WORD of God, and the cares of this world, the deceitfulness of riches, and the desire for other things entering in choke The WORD, and it (The Word) becomes unfruitful. (Mark 4:18 through 19). According to Jesus, cares our spiritual thorns. They can be overwhelming material burdens and exhausting emotional affairs--- or worry's.
